#66f2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#66f2ce is composed of 40% red, 94.9%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.9%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 164.6 degrees, a saturation of 84.3% and a lightness of 67.5%. #66f2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ffff with #00e59d.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#66f2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#66f2ce has RGB values of R:102, G:242,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 6746830.

Shades and Tints of #66f2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a07 is the darkest color, while #f7f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#66f2ce
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6b2af is the less saturated color, while #59ffd4 is the most saturated one.
